Dad Nicknames from Different Cultures

Language/CountryNicknameMeaning/Note
SpanishPapá, PapiAffectionate and common
FrenchPapaUniversal, warm
ItalianPapà, BabboRegional variations
GermanVati, PapaVati is more childlike
HindiPapa, BabujiBabuji is respectfully traditional
JapaneseOtōsan, PapaOtōsan is formal, Papa is casual
AfrikaansPappaSouth African tradition
PortuguesePai, PapaiPapai is childlike affection

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What should I consider when picking a nickname for my dad?

A: Think about his personality, hobbies, and cultural background. Avoid nicknames that might offend him or ones he’d be uncomfortable with around friends or family.

Q: Can I use more than one nickname for my dad?

A: Absolutely! Many families use different nicknames for different moods or occasions. Mix and match as you like.

Q: Are there nicknames for step-dads or father figures?

A: Of course. Names like Bonus Dad, Pop, or Coach are perfect for step-dads, guardians, mentors, and father figures who play a big role in your life.

Q: What if my dad doesn’t like the nickname I chose?

A: Respect his feelings. Try asking him for suggestions or brainstorm together to find something he enjoys.

Q: How do you introduce the nickname to others?

A: Naturally include it in conversation or family gatherings. You can also introduce it as part of a family story or inside joke!
